scenePhaseを使うとバックグラウンドになった時に通知されるのだが、Modal Viewが表示されているときは呼び出されなかった。 struct MessageView: View { @Environment(\.scenePhase) private var scenePhase @Binding var isPresented: Bool var body: some View { Text("バックグラウンドになると閉じます.") .onChange(of: scenePhase) { newPhase in switch(newPhase) { case .inactive, …